Output 62700e17db0702ab1b1bf3c703cbfb0fd1aa3ed56515aa2b422314fd1fec9308:0

value
9475080538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d62fa536a8029a46e9d0e5afcac242a50e8b8e8 OP_EQUAL
address
MHsYTSVJqEJifCe5MavyqYd92k41MbdXV4
transaction
62700e17db0702ab1b1bf3c703cbfb0fd1aa3ed56515aa2b422314fd1fec9308
spent
true